Output 577cc68b54bfc83606f5518f0e89cd17323e121407b14fd78575d3d471d3033c:1

value
29710530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0c219cef46b3a154854881d8072475e7375a84 OP_EQUAL
address
3LCddPAJMPKRvnXgC9DWuikgunkCBLr7gS
transaction
577cc68b54bfc83606f5518f0e89cd17323e121407b14fd78575d3d471d3033c
spent
true